Almost all of the larger players in the telecom industry provide ongoing training classes for new employees that are offered round the year.
You can apply to become a telecom operator as long as you have at least a high-school diploma. There are also open sales positions that are often available to people who are willing to complete some of the job training courses. Many younger workers will find telemarketing to be a great way to gain job experience and they can even apply for part time positions that can be worked around their college schedules. Older workers, who may be retired, can also find this a very good opportunity.
If you are interested in applying for a position in telecommunications, you will need to understand the duties that are directly related to the job. Having a college degree may not be essential, but it will certainly help you if you are applying for the higher paying positions. It is very important to have some basic knowledge of computers and you should be able to deal with the public in a calm, professional manner at all times. A good speaking voice, good hearing, and a relaxed and friendly communication manner will help you secure a position in customer assistance.
There are a number of telecom positions that will require workers to have a certain amount of specialized expertise. For example, most technicians will need a strong foundation that could require experience in SSIR/IR installations (which includes the DSL network) or designing voice networks. It will also be helpful for applicants to be able to demonstrate a track record for resolving problems that involve system software, or equipment. LAN environments and other complex systems require specialized training for most entry-level workers who are applying for these open positions.
